The location of Kholo was obtained by an [[Unnamed Sangheili Shipmaster (The Return)|unnamed Sangheili Shipmaster]] from the incomplete data banks of a captured human [[freighter]]. Upon returning with the information to the [[High Council]], the Shipmaster was ordered to take command of the [[Fleet of Righteous Vigilance]] and destroy Kholo, under the watchful eye of the [[Prophet of Conviction]].<ref name="evo"/>

==The battle==
The [[Human]] orbital defenses maintained only a few small military vessels and a number of freighters in orbit. These were overwhelmed and destroyed by the fleet's scout vessels. When the main fleet arrived, ground forces were deployed to the surface, before being withdrawn after two days to clear the way for the orbital bombardment to follow. The Shipmaster leading the fleet was ordered by the Prophet of Conviction to manually control his cruiser's energy projector and carve the Covenant glyph for "Faith" into the surface of the planet. Upon completion of the glyph, the rest of the fleet opened fire and completely glassed Kholo. The battle was an overwhelming Covenant victory with Kholo being [[Glassing|glassed]], killing a large amount of [[civilian]]s and UNSC personnel trapped on the planet.<ref name="evo"/>
